Transaction 625186fd5e8721f40969c13bfbfe9cca45ed9489399a8bdeedab3f17370e0851
2 Input
2 Outputs
- 625186fd5e8721f40969c13bfbfe9cca45ed9489399a8bdeedab3f17370e0851:0
- 625186fd5e8721f40969c13bfbfe9cca45ed9489399a8bdeedab3f17370e0851:1
value 6980000
address 1BWY8MM4W9bpwaTnBc94S2zQvNNwoWBGhf
value 25670000
address 16BF7oqbdPkG3Xd2WAEdvMCGRbCHNUyGjT